Salim Kipkemboi is a Kenyan cyclist riding for Bike Aid.[1]

Kipkemobi joined Bike Aid in 2017 and continued riding for them into 2018.[2]

He won stage 3, the queen stage, of the 2018 Sharjah International Cycling Tour for his first career victory.[3] He won the stage in a four-man sprint to the end.[4]

Major results

2017
7th Overall Tour Meles Zenawi
2018
4th Overall Sharjah International Cycling Tour
1st Young rider classification
1st Stage 3
10th Overall La Tropicale Amissa Bongo
